× I usually buy shoes online because it is more convenient and than going shopping.
✓ I usually buy shoes online because it is more convenient than going shopping.
The conjunction 'and' is incorrectly used before 'than'. The correct comparative structure is 'more convenient than', so 'and' should be removed.

× Come to think of it, I'm working at school so I have a numerous physical activities like walking around and going upstairs and lifting heavy box boxes, some kind of like that so it is more comfortable.
✓ Come to think of it, I work at a school, so I have numerous physical activities like walking around, going upstairs, and lifting heavy boxes, so comfort is important.
'I'm working at school' is better as 'I work at a school' for habitual action. 'A numerous physical activities' is incorrect; 'numerous' does not take 'a'. 'Heavy box boxes' is redundant; 'heavy boxes' is correct. The sentence is long and needs punctuation for clarity.
